Output e81a8a1fb2388591881cd31b826eb0cfd2f10fb74d584e1306bfea52e16509dc:0

value
15353988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 289da0fc0a54641e38ee300c64290baacd429ead OP_EQUAL
address
35PmnThgKDqUbBZbjogsaeEC4SxhGmYrj6
transaction
e81a8a1fb2388591881cd31b826eb0cfd2f10fb74d584e1306bfea52e16509dc
spent
true